Output ef696608e38e7d62f57719272538c2dfac919cb3f4a44783449beaf62c935a57:24
- value
- 2083019
- script pubkey
- OP_0 OP_PUSHBYTES_20 6edb37da3c12b61e582f97a5cd4ee1758726f855
- address
- bc1qdmdn0k3uz2mpukp0j7ju6nhpwkrjd7z47wzlnf
- transaction
- ef696608e38e7d62f57719272538c2dfac919cb3f4a44783449beaf62c935a57